Śrīmad-Bhāgavatam
<< Canto 12, The Age of Deterioration >> << 7 - The Purāṇic Literatures >>
<< VERSE 13 >>
vṛttir bhūtāni bhūtānāṁ carāṇām acarāṇi ca kṛtā svena nṛṇāṁ tatra kāmāc codanayāpi vā
WORD BY WORD
TRANSLATION
| Vṛtti means the process of sustenance, by which the moving beings live upon the nonmoving. For a human, vṛtti specifically means acting for one’s livelihood in a manner suited to his personal nature. Such action may be carried out either in pursuit of selfish desire or in accordance with the law of God.
